Does Gastroscopy Induce Myocardial Ischemia in Patients With Coronary Heart Disease?

Abstract

Gastroscopy is potentially a harmful procedure for CHD patients, but the incidence of ischemic periods may be reduced by conscious sedation and, if the patient is receiving beta-blocking agent therapy, by applying this medication prior to gastroscopy.
